Jessica Galang joins The Logic as a reporter

By The Logic
Jan 7, 2019

Jessica Galang, former news editor at BetaKit, will join the reporting team. Read more in this note to staff from editor-in-chief David Skok.

Hi all,

I am absolutely delighted to announce that Jessica Galang will be joining The Logic as a reporter based in Toronto.

Jessica is, simply put, a force of nature. Over the past three years, she has written hundreds of articles on Canada’s tech sector and, in the process, has grown into one of Canada’s preeminent archivists of the tech ecosystem. She has also played a key role in shaping the tech site BetaKit as its news editor, where she cultivated and helped mentor a new generation of voices and talent.

Our commitment to Jessica and our readers is that she’ll get to apply her wealth of experience through a wider lens, putting a spotlight on the countless entrepreneurs and organizations that have helped build an ecosystem that is the envy of the world. But it’s also an ecosystem that, with more capital and attention, has raised expectations, increased pressure and, as a result, left some feeling marginalized—unable to access the opportunity that Canada’s tech ecosystem now affords.

I first saw Jessica moderate a panel at a conference 18 months ago. Her intellect, passion and curiosity was clear. Those characteristics have only been reinforced in the time that I’ve gotten to know her since. She also shares the focus and ambition that you all have—which is so vital to our future success.

Jessica’s arrival—along with the Information Accelerator Program starting next week in San Francisco—will help us sharpen our focus heading into 2019. I couldn’t think of a better way to march in the new year.

Jessica’s first day will be Tuesday.

Please join me in welcoming her to the team.
